Definition: SAP Solutions
SAP solutions refer to a suite of enterprise resource planning (ERP) applications designed to manage business operations and customer relations comprehensively. These solutions integrate various functions, such as finance, supply chain, and human resources, into a unified system.

Architecture Patterns
When planning to adopt SAP solutions, organizations must understand various architecture patterns that can optimize the deployment of these systems. The architecture of SAP solutions typically consists of three layers: presentation, application, and database. Each layer serves a distinct purpose, and decisions made at each level can significantly impact overall performance and costs.
- Presentation Layer: This is where user interactions occur, typically through a web interface or SAP GUI. Decisions regarding the user experience and access controls can determine the efficacy of the application in real-world scenarios. A poorly designed presentation layer may lead to user errors or resistance to adoption.
- Application Layer: This layer houses the business logic and processes. Choosing between on-premises and cloud deployment can affect how well the application scales with organizational needs. Each option presents unique challenges in terms of maintenance, upgrades, and integration with other systems.
- Database Layer: Data storage choices, including relational databases and in-memory databases, dictate how efficiently data can be retrieved and processed. The decision to utilize a particular database technology can create constraints on performance and scalability, which is vital for long-term operational success.
Understanding these architectural layers can help organizations identify potential failure points and align their SAP migration strategy with broader business objectives.
Implementation Trade-offs
The implementation of SAP solutions involves numerous trade-offs that can affect both short-term and long-term outcomes. Decision-makers must consider factors such as cost, complexity, and user adoption when choosing their migration path.
- Cost vs. Features: While it may be tempting to opt for the latest features available in SAP solutions, organizations must weigh these benefits against the associated costs of implementation and ongoing maintenance. For instance, adding advanced analytics tools may enhance operational intelligence but could burden the organization with additional licensing and infrastructure costs.
- Customization vs. Standardization: Customizing SAP solutions to fit unique business processes can lead to increased complexity and future upgrade challenges. Organizations must carefully assess whether a customized approach will yield sufficient long-term value compared to using standardized processes that may better align with industry best practices.
- Speed vs. Thoroughness: The pressure to implement solutions quickly can lead to rushed deployments, resulting in overlooked governance and compliance implications. Organizations should prioritize thorough testing and validation of all systems before going live, despite the potential delays this may introduce.
By understanding these trade-offs, organizations can make informed decisions that align with their operational and strategic goals.
Governance Requirements
Effective governance is a foundational element that underpins the successful implementation of SAP solutions. Organizations must establish a comprehensive governance framework that addresses data management, compliance, and risk mitigation.
- Data Management: Organizations should adhere to frameworks such as the Data Management Body of Knowledge (DAMA-DMBOK), which emphasizes data governance, quality, and lifecycle management. Failure to implement robust data management practices can lead to inconsistent data quality and compliance violations.
- Compliance Frameworks: Regulatory compliance, such as GDPR for data protection, mandates that organizations have clear policies governing data usage, retention, and access. Implementing SAP solutions without aligning these frameworks can expose organizations to legal liabilities and penalties.
- Stakeholder Engagement: Effective governance requires the involvement of various stakeholders, including IT, legal, compliance, and business users. Establishing a governance committee to oversee SAP implementation can help ensure that all perspectives are considered and that risks are adequately managed.
By addressing governance requirements, organizations can mitigate risks associated with data integrity and compliance while gaining confidence in their SAP migration efforts.
Failure Modes
Understanding potential failure modes can help organizations proactively address challenges during their migration to SAP solutions. Common failure modes include:
- Integration Failures: Poor integration between SAP solutions and existing legacy systems can lead to data silos and inconsistencies. Organizations should assess their integration strategy carefully, ensuring that data flows seamlessly across systems.
- User Resistance: End-user resistance is a common challenge during SAP migrations. Insufficient training and change management efforts can lead to low adoption rates and suboptimal usage of the new system. Organizations must implement comprehensive training programs to ensure users are equipped to leverage the new functionalities.
- Data Quality Issues: Migrating data without proper validation can result in quality issues, such as duplicated entries or missing information. Organizations should develop a data cleansing strategy before migration, ensuring that only high-quality data is transferred to the new system.
By identifying and addressing these failure modes, organizations can enhance their SAP migration strategies and reduce the likelihood of costly setbacks.

Decision Matrix Table
| Decision | Options | Selection Logic | Hidden Costs |
|---|---|---|---|
| Database Technology | Relational vs. In-Memory | Evaluate performance and scalability | Increased licensing fees for in-memory solutions |
| Deployment Model | On-Premises vs. Cloud | Consider maintenance and upgrade costs | Potential data transfer costs during migration |
| Customization Level | High vs. Low Customization | Analyze long-term support implications | Increased complexity during upgrades |
